Yogi Berra Predicting the Future: Wisdom Through His Famous Quotes

Yogi Berra is famous for his paradoxical statements that often seem to predict the future through self-fulfilling insight. His quotes blend wit, wisdom, and irony, creating a unique lens for forecasting outcomes in sports, business, and life.

By treating Yogi Berra predictions as case studies in human behavior and probability, readers can better anticipate turning points and manage uncertainty. This article explores how his sayings function as practical forecasting tools rather than mere jokes.

"It ain't over till it's over." "When you come to a fork in the road, take it." "It's déjà vu all over again." "The future ain't what it used to be."

Yogi Berra Prediction Mechanics

How Seemingly Simple Lines Forecast Behavior

Yogi Berra prediction mechanics focus on how his statements shape decisions. By framing uncertainty plainly, his words reduce denial and encourage proactive moves. Teams and investors use these lines as reality checks against overconfidence.

The humor lowers resistance to uncomfortable truths, making it easier to act on early warnings. When outcomes align loosely with his quotes, people cite confirmation, yet the broader lesson is about preparing for multiple paths.

Applying Yogi Berra Forecasting to Business

Turning Wisdom into Strategic Foresight

Leaders use Yogi Berra forecasting to stress-test strategies against unexpected twists. By asking what could make a plan fail, they identify weak links before crises expose them.

Regularly revisiting his lines encourages humility and continuous learning. Organizations that normalize dissent and near-miss reviews build resilience that turns caution into competitive advantage.
